预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于Petri网的电子运维系统工作流建模 为满足现代电子化、信息化、智能化和可视化等多种业务需求,工业企业越来越需要快速响应市场的变化,解决系统故障和优化系统性能。在这样的情况下,电子运维系统成为了一个必须具备的关键工具。为了让运维系统更加高效、自动化和可控,利用Petri网对其进行建模,可以使系统的运行逻辑更加清晰、可预见和可管理。 Petri网以简单而直观的形式表示系统状态和状态转移,因此常用于工业自动化领域中的建模和分析。基于Petri网的运维系统工作流建模,可以把整个运维流程划分成若干个子流程,分别建立Petri网模型,由此实现系统工作流智能化控制。 电子运维系统主要由故障检测、故障诊断、故障分析、故障处理、数据采集、数据处理、性能分析等几个主要模块组成。将在此正式介绍如何利用Petri网对这几个模块进行建模。 故障检测模块可以被建模为一个简单的Petri网,该Petri网由两个状态组成:发现错误和未发现错误。进入运行状态之后,Petri网会一直监听整个系统,以便及时发现任何新的错误状态。 故障诊断模块则可以建模为一个带有多个子网的Petri网,每个子网都可以用于表示不同的故障类型。当有新的错误被发现时,Petri网将会帮助运维人员定位错误的具体位置和相关信息。 故障分析模块可以被建模为一个带有资源池和任务调度的Petri网,资源池中包含了运维系统中所有可调用的分析工具和模型,任务调度员将会根据当前系统的状态和故障类型来派单和分配分析任务。 故障处理模块是整个运维系统的核心模块,也是最为复杂的模块之一。该模块可以被建模为一个带有条件和循环结构的Petri网,在这个Petri网中,运维人员将会根据错误类型和处理策略选择相应的处理工具,然后根据工作流程中的条件和循环,开始执行错误处理操作,直到解决问题。 数据采集、数据处理和性能分析三个模块可以被视为一个整体进行建模,这个整体模块可以被表示为Petri网的一个状态转移图。在此模型中,不断运行的Petri网将会分布式地收集系统的性能数据,然后根据用户设定的数据处理规则进行处理,最后输出一些关键性能指标,以供系统维护人员参考。 总之,在利用Petri网建模电子运维系统时所需要注意的是,模型的设计必须具备一定的系统性和综合性,同时需要充分考虑不同模块之间的相互作用和协调。基于Petri网的建模方法可以使电子运维系统变得更加高效、自动化和可控,从而大大提高了整个系统的稳定性和可靠性,进一步优化了公司的生产效率和经济效益。